Biography

This petite brunette gained her first experience on the Chicago stage in productions at companies such as Steppenwolf, Organic and Eclipse (of which she was one of the founding members). Within five months of her move to Los Angeles, Pietz had appeared in an episode of the police drama "Missing Persons" (ABC, 1993), the feature "Rudy" (1993) and later joined the cast of the fledgling Warner Bros.
